Populations Served Notes

The PAVSA Safe Harbor Regional Navigator serves as a point of contact for individuals, families and communities throughout Northeast Minnesota (Cook, Lake, St. Louis, Koochiching and Carlton Counties).

Geographic Service Area

The Safe Harbor Regional Navigator for Northeast Minnesota offers support, referrals, and case consultation in 5 counties for youth under 24 years of age. If they are located in St. Louis County, direct services are available through Safe Harbor Services.

Mission Statement

PAVSA is dedicated to the elimination of sexual violence in Southern St. Louis County through supporting victims, educating the community, and advocating for change. Our core values include free and accessible services that are victim-centered and victim-driven. We are committed to providing support services for victims of sexual violence, educating and building awareness in the community and advocating for social change in the many systems that interact with victims following a sexual assault.
